Flame Retardant Cable Testing

Flame-retardant cables are designed to prevent or limit the spread of fire when exposed to a flame source.

A Wires and Cables Testing Lab performs several flame performance evaluations.

Flame Propagation Testing

This test determines how effectively a cable resists flame spread along its length.

The evaluation measures:

  • Flame spread distance

  • Burning duration

  • Self-extinguishing characteristics

Flame propagation testing is essential for cables installed in buildings, tunnels, and industrial facilities.


Fire Resistance Testing

Fire-resistant cables must continue supplying electrical power during a fire to support emergency systems.

Testing evaluates:

  • Circuit integrity

  • Electrical continuity

  • Operational performance under fire exposure

  • Resistance to high temperatures

Fire resistance testing is especially important for:

  • Fire alarm systems

  • Emergency lighting

  • Smoke extraction systems

  • Emergency communication networks

  • Critical industrial processes


Smoke Density Testing

Smoke generated during a fire significantly affects visibility and evacuation.

A Wires and Cables Testing Lab measures:

  • Smoke generation

  • Smoke density

  • Light transmission

Low-smoke cables improve evacuation safety and reduce hazards for emergency responders.


Halogen Gas Emission Testing

Some cable materials release corrosive and toxic gases during combustion.

Testing evaluates:

  • Hydrogen chloride emissions

  • Acid gas generation

  • Halogen content

Low Smoke Zero Halogen (LSZH) cables minimize toxic emissions and reduce equipment corrosion during fire incidents.


Glow Wire Testing

Glow wire testing evaluates the resistance of cable insulation materials to heat generated by overloaded electrical components.

The test helps verify:

  • Ignition resistance

  • Material stability

  • Fire prevention capability

This assessment improves the safety of cable insulation materials.

International Standards Used

A Wires and Cables Testing Lab performs testing according to internationally recognized standards.

Common standards include:

Fire Performance

  • IEC 60332 series – Flame propagation tests

  • IEC 60331 series – Fire resistance tests

  • IEC 61034 series – Smoke density measurement

  • IEC 60754 series – Halogen gas emission testing

Electrical Performance

  • IEC 60502 – Power cables

  • IEC 60227 – PVC insulated cables

  • IEC 60228 – Conductors of insulated cables

Environmental Protection

  • IEC 60529 – Ingress Protection (IP)

Testing according to these standards supports regulatory compliance and global market acceptance.
